About the Recruitment
UKPSC has announced this drive to fill 25 vacancies for the post of Veterinary Officer — 20 posts through general recruitment and 5 posts under special backlog recruitment. Do keep in mind that the number of vacancies is subject to revision as per the official notification, so it's worth checking the PDF for the latest category-wise breakup before you apply.
The post itself is a Group 'B' Gazetted position, and candidates selected will be responsible for veterinary care and animal husbandry services across the state.
Eligibility Criteria
Educational Qualification
To apply for this post, you need:
- A Bachelor's Degree in Veterinary Science and Animal Husbandry (B.V.Sc. & A.H.), or an equivalent qualification recognised under the Indian Veterinary Council Act, 1984.
- Mandatory registration with the Uttarakhand Veterinary Council.
If your degree is from outside Uttarakhand or from a different council, make sure your registration transfer is sorted before the application deadline — this is a common bottleneck candidates run into.
Age Limit
- Minimum age: 21 years
- Maximum age: 42 years
- Calculated as on 1 July 2026, meaning candidates should be born between 2 July 1984 and 1 July 2005.
- Age relaxation is applicable for reserved categories as per Uttarakhand government rules — refer to the official notification for exact relaxation slabs.
Salary and Pay Scale
Selected candidates will be placed at Pay Level-10, drawing a pay scale of ₹56,100 to ₹1,77,500 per month. Your actual in-hand salary will vary based on applicable allowances (DA, HRA, etc.), deductions, and your posting location, so treat the pay scale as the base rather than the final take-home figure.

Selection Process
The selection for UKPSC Veterinary Officer 2026 typically follows a structured process that includes a written (objective-type) examination followed by document verification. A few important points to note:
- The written exam carries negative marking — one-fourth of the marks allotted to a question is deducted for every wrong answer, so guesswork can cost you.
- Calculators are not permitted for any candidate in this exam, including PwD candidates (the talking-calculator provision does not apply here).
Facilities for PwD Candidates
UKPSC has laid out clear provisions for candidates with disabilities:
- A scribe is permitted for candidates with blindness, both-arms-affected locomotor disability, or cerebral palsy, and for others who submit a certificate from a government hospital confirming they cannot write due to their condition.
- Approved candidates get 20 minutes of compensatory time per hour of examination (minimum 5 minutes, in multiples of 5).
- Ground-floor seating is guaranteed for eligible candidates.
